I am playing Sims4 on PC, Japanese and suddenly one day the alt key stopped working.
List of things I did to fix the problem. ↓
・Remove mods.
・Play with new save data.
・Initialize Sims4.
・Fixed the game on EA app and STEAM.
・Reinstall Sims4.
・Turn off the overlay in EA Apps and STEAM.
・Update windows.
・Intel update.
・ Keyboard driver updates.
・Disk cleanup and defragmentation.
・Clean boot.
・Change keyboard settings.
・New keyboard.
And much more.
Still, it did not fix the problem.
I now use the screen keyboard only when I want free placement of objects as a temporary fix.
It is a bit silly, but the ALT key on the screen keyboard is reflected in the Sims4 game.
